A Security Operations Center (SOC) is a centralized team responsible for monitoring, detecting, investigating, and responding to cybersecurity incidents across an organization.
The primary purpose of a SOC is to provide continuous security operations and protect business assets from cyber threats.
A SOC helps organizations maintain visibility across their IT environment and respond quickly to threats. It also supports regulatory compliance and improves overall security posture.

Managed Detection and Response (MDR) is a cybersecurity service where a third-party security provider monitors, detects, investigates, and responds to threats on behalf of an organization.
Rather than building an internal security team, businesses can rely on cybersecurity experts to manage threat detection and response activities.
MDR providers use advanced security tools, threat intelligence, and skilled analysts to identify suspicious activity across endpoints, networks, and cloud environments.
When threats are detected, the provider investigates the incident and takes action to contain or eliminate the risk.

Extended Detection and Response (XDR) is a technology-driven security solution that integrates data from multiple security tools into a single platform.
Unlike traditional security systems that operate independently, XDR combines information from endpoints, networks, cloud environments, email systems, and other security layers to provide broader visibility.
XDR gathers and correlates data from various sources, helping security teams identify threats that may otherwise go unnoticed.
By connecting different security controls, XDR enables faster investigations and more accurate threat detection.

When evaluating MDR vs SOC, organizations should consider operational requirements, resources, and security objectives.
| Feature | SOC | MDR |
|---|---|---|
| Security Monitoring | Managed internally | Managed by external experts |
| Threat Detection | Internal security team | Provider-led monitoring |
| Response Capabilities | Handled by in-house analysts | Managed by provider |
| Staffing Requirements | High | Low |
| Cost | Higher setup and operational costs | Subscription-based pricing |
| Management Responsibilities | Organization manages operations | Provider manages security activities |
| Best-Fit Organizations | Large enterprises with security teams | SMBs and resource-limited organizations |
A SOC provides full control but requires significant investment. MDR offers expert support without the complexity of building an internal security operation.
The discussion around SOC vs XDR often causes confusion because they serve different purposes.
A SOC is a security function and team, while XDR is a technology platform that enhances security monitoring and investigation.
| Feature | SOC | XDR |
| Visibility | Depends on deployed tools | Unified visibility across systems |
| Data Sources | Multiple separate tools | Integrated data collection |
| Threat Detection | Analyst-driven | Analytics and automation-driven |
| Automation | Limited to available tools | Advanced automation capabilities |
| Investigation Process | Manual and tool-dependent | Centralized investigations |
| Scalability | Requires additional staffing | Easier to scale through technology |
| Deployment Approach | Operational model | Technology platform |
Many organizations use XDR technology within their SOC environment to improve efficiency and detection capabilities.

Choosing the right cybersecurity solution depends on your organization’s size, resources, and security requirements.
Small businesses often benefit from MDR because it provides expert protection without requiring a dedicated security team.
Mid-sized companies may choose MDR, XDR, or a combination of both depending on internal capabilities and growth plans.
Large organizations frequently operate a SOC supported by advanced technologies such as XDR to improve monitoring and response.
Organizations with limited resources can gain immediate access to skilled security professionals through managed services.
Businesses operating in regulated sectors such as finance, healthcare, and government often require continuous monitoring, incident reporting, and detailed security visibility. SOC, MDR, and XDR can all contribute to compliance efforts when implemented effectively.
